  • The critics have been writing me off for 20 years. That's nothing new. As far as I know I still have plenty of fans and sell lots of records. Do I care what critics say about me? No, and I don't read reviews.

  • My goal from the very beginning was just to write good songs that don't require any production to be felt or understood. I wanted to be able to sit in a room with a guitar and play the song from beginning to end and have it be as impactful as if you heard the studio version with all the bells and whistles.

    "Pop Sovereign: A Conversation With Madonna". Interview With T. Cole Rachel, pitchfork.com. March 2, 2015.
  • Who is my role model and how long can I keep this going? I just move around and do different things and come back to music, try making films and come back to music, write children's books and come back to music.

    "Madonnarama!". Interview with Rich Cohen, www.vanityfair.com. May 2008.
  • When I discovered that I could write music, it felt like the most natural way for me to connect with people and tell my stories. I've always thought of that as what I do: I tell stories.

    "Pop Sovereign: A Conversation With Madonna". Interview With T. Cole Rachel, pitchfork.com. March 2, 2015.
  • When you're writing something and you know it's good, you get flushed, you can feel the blood coursing through your veins, you feel alive, all your nerve endings stand up, something just clicks.

  • I didn't set out to write certain kinds of songs - I just set out to write good songs.

    "The Unapologetic Madonna Interview: The Queen Of Pop On Grindr, Song Leaks, Her Kids, And More". Interview with Dan Avery, www.newnownext.com. March 10, 2015.
  • I worship F. Scott Fitzgerald and I love his writing.

    Source: www.harpersbazaar.com
  • I know there's a lot of competition in the world of magazines and newspapers and we have to make headlines and be sensational and sell, and saying bad things about me is going to sell more papers than writing good things about me.

    Source: www.theguardian.com
  • Sometimes I was in a mood to write a song as if I was writing in my journal and reveal certain parts of me that I was ready to reveal.

    "The Unapologetic Madonna Interview: The Queen Of Pop On Grindr, Song Leaks, Her Kids, And More". Interview with Dan Avery, www.newnownext.com. March 10, 2015.
